It's not a juvenile (from this year) ... juveniles of both species have a lot of white spots on their back and wing feathers. Juveniles in my part of Maryland haven't left their nests yet and I suspect they haven't on the New Jersey coast either.

It is a Yellow-crowned Night-Heron, as it has the all-dark bill and more graceful, longer-necked appearance of that species.
